New appointments to the Supreme and County Courts.

Decorative
The College warmly congratulates Associate Justice Patricia Matthews and Peter Gray KC on their appointments as Judges of the Supreme Court of Victoria. We also extend our congratulations to Diana Manova and Robyn Harper on their appointments as Judges of the County Court of Victoria.

Justice Gray has practiced at the Victorian Bar since 1996 in public law and regulatory and commercial law, and made Silk in 2011. He has acted as a Senior Counsel Assisting for the Royal Commission into Aged Care Quality and Safety and the Royal Commission into Defence and Veteran Suicide. He was Senior Counsel representing the State in the Royal Commission into the Casino Operator and Licence

Justice Matthews was appointed an Associate Judge of the Supreme Court of Victoria in December 2020, having served as a judicial registrar of the Court since 2017. She was previously a solicitor working across commercial court and common law matters and has worked as a senior fellow at the University of Melbourne Law School.

Judge Manova has practised at the Victorian Bar since 2001, and since 2012 predominantly in common law, insurance and personal injury law. She has also regularly appeared as a prosecutor in criminal trials in the higher courts and has also prosecuted for the Independent Broad-based Anti-corruption Commission.

Judge Harper has served as Crown Prosecutor for the Office of Public Prosecutions since 2018. Judge Harper has practised at the Victorian Bar since 2009 and has appeared for both the prosecution and defence in the Magistrates’, County and Supreme Courts.
